    Healthy Pumpkin Brownies (Flourless!)

    INGREDIENTS IN MY HEALTHY PUMPKIN BROWNIES

    My fudgy pumpkin brownies are made with healthy ingredients for a fun fall treat you can feed the whole family, toddlers included!

    • Pumpkin puree from organic canned pumpkin or homemade pumpkin puree.
    • Almond butter. I love almond butter because it adds protein and healthy fats.
    • Egg from my local farmer!
    • Pure maple syrup. Make sure you get pure and not imitation.
    • Pure vanilla extract. Make sure your vanilla is pure too.
    • Cacao powder is higher in nutrients that cocoa powder.
    • Baking soda
    • Pink sea salt. I love using pink salt which is less refined than bleached table salt.

    TIPS TO MAKE THE BEST DENSE FUDGY PUMPKIN BROWNIE RECIPE EVER!

    MIX VERY WELL! Almond butter tends to clump as it sits in the cupboard and settles. Make sure to mix it till its totally smooth and then stir it into your pumpkin brownie batter very well too.

    USE FRESH SPICES. It's tempting to use up spices from the back of the cupboard, but the longer you've stored them, the less potent they become. Spices are the one thing I would never buy in bulk and instead buy a small jar at the beginning of the season.

    USE CACAO POWDER. Cacao powder will give your healthy pumpkin brownies even more healthy benefits since it is less refined than standard cocoa powder.

    BAKE PUMPKIN BROWNIES TILL JUST DONE. Don't overbake your brownies or they will turn out dry instead of fudgy.

    HOW TO MAKE FUDGY PUMPKIN BROWNIES IN 1 BOWL

    Grab 1 bowl and preheat your o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it, my healthy chocolate pumpkin brownies will be done in under 1 hour!

    STEP 1 MIX PUMPKIN BROWNIE BATTER

    In a bowl, add all of your ingredients:

    • 1 cup pumpkin puree
    • 1 cup smooth almond butter
    • 1 egg
    • Β½ cup pure maple syrup
    • Β½ cup cacao powder
    • 1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
    • Β½ teaspoon baking soda
    • ΒΌ teaspoon pink sea salt

    Mix very well until there are no pumpkin or almond butter lumps.

    STEP 2 BAKE

    Line an 8 x 8 square baking pan with parchment paper. Use 8 x 8 and not 9 x 9. A 9 x 9 pan will give you very thin pumpkin brownies!

    Spread your pumpkin brownie batter evenly into your pan.

    Bake in the center rack of your oven for 20-25 minutes depending on how hot your oven runs.

    Healthy pumpkin brownie batter
    Healthy pumpkin brownie batter

    STEP 3 COOL AND ENJOY!

    Remove your brownies from your oven as soon as the center is done and a toothpick comes out with crumbs and not batter. You're not looking for a clean toothpick, as this would tell you you've probably baked them too long.

    Allow your pumpkin brownies to cool completely before slicing and eating.

    FAQS

    WHAT CAN I USE AS A SWEETENER IN PLACE OF THE MAPLE SYRUP?

    You can use honey, date syrup, 1 mashed extra ripe banana, coconut sugar, or brown sugar.

    ARE THESE PUMPKIN BROWNIES GLUTEN FREE?

    Yes! These are totally gluten free friendly.

    HOW DO I MAKE THESE PUMPKIN BROWNIES VEGAN FRIENDLY?

    Simply replace the 1 egg with 1 flax seed egg.

    Mix 1 tablespoon ground flax seeds with 2 tablespoons water.

    CAN I MAKE THESE PUMPKIN BROWNIES WITH NO CHOCOLATE?

    Yes! You can replace the cacao powder with almond flour for a pure pumpkin brownie, maybe I'd call this version a pumpkin blondie. πŸ™‚
